Teacher Grants

Each year, we solicit applications for innovative teacher grants.  All grade levels are welcome to apply for funding for projects up; to $2,000 that provide students with work-based learning in the classroom and align with FCPS Portrait of a Graduate outcomes.

Our 2023-2024 grant cycle awarded 57 grants for a total of $95,000.

Grant Assistance

Educate Fairfax can facilitate online or text-to-give fundraising campaigns for specific projects or programs at schools.  We will support fundraising activities that expressly benefit FCPS students and staff.

Examples include (see the bottom of this page for details on some of our specific campaigns):

  • Special events
  • Alumni giving or reunion campaigns
  • Class Gifts
  • A dedicated donation link for school (can be featured in publications such as newsletters, even programs, graduation materials, etc.)

Along with the FCPS Grants Development Office, Educate Fairfax is available to assist FCPS teachers, administrators and support personnel in seeking grant opportunities for programs. If a grant opportunity that you are seeking requires the grant to be paid to a 501c3 non-profit, we may be able to assist you.

Judith Diesenhaus Campaign

Judith was a long-time FCPS librarian with a passion for sharing her love of reading.  Donations in her name funded an online audiobook collection that can be accessed by all FCPS high school students.

Robinson HS Class of 1999

In celebration of their 20th reunion, the Robinson class of 1999 donated to an existing scholarship fund in memory of a beloved classmate and friend.

Lemon Road Lions Den

With the return of students in the spring of 2021, Lemon Road ES wanted a safe space for students to gather.  Donations went towards outfitting an outdoor space for socializing.
